Male suspect with assault warrant arrested in domestic caseLong Beach CA

audio iconFamily Offense
Long Beach, CA

Police responded to a domestic violence call in Long Beach, CA. A male suspect with an outstanding warrant for assault and injury to a spouse was located. The victim initially walked away but was persuaded to return by a relative. The suspect, who was under an active protective order and known to flee from police, was identified and taken into custody.

Police codes explained
The following codes appeared in the transcript and are explained below:
[1]
10-4: Acknowledgment or affirmative; message received and understood.
[2]
Code 4: No further assistance needed; situation under control.
